Description
The following contract opportunity invites suitably experienced suppliers to design digital and hard copy templates for the stages of SSSI notification and the making of PSS from:
Early engagement
Through to formal consultation
Through to implementation
The main outputs will be:
Desk study research into contemporary approaches to the design of templates for this section of the Advisory Guidance.
Formation of the first version of the Protected Site Strategies Advisory Guidance section on how to make a PSS
Formation of revised guidance and template for SSSI notification, based on the desk study research and other research insights gleaned by the PSS project team.
Produce a storyboard style draft to reflect the recommended approach. This could be presented in PDF format with an accompanying PowerPoint presentation. We are, however, open to alternative suitable digital presentations.
The resolved design to frame the templates and accompanying guidance in a way that is visually attractive. In the case of Protected Site Strategies, the guidance will be hosted on our SPOL site with capacity to later share with partners on their external websites. The SSSI notification guidance is also currently hosted on SPOL Site Selection & Designation (sharepoint.com).
